Other / Miscellaneous Getting 2,000+ creepy messages from random numbers.đwhat can I do?
My friend has been getting 2,000+ creepy messages over the last 10 days from different numbers. Along with these, she also gets random OTPs/login attempts from apps like Zomato, Zepto, Jio and others.
One pattern she noticed is that almost every number is a verified Truecaller account with a name and a UPI ID/bank account attached to it.(for example, the attached screenshot shows the name âLaxmi Sharmaâ on Truecaller, but when checked on PhonePe, it shows âSachin Thakur) So these don't seem to be random/fake numbers , they appear to be genuine, active numbers.
Blocking/reporting doesn't help because a different number is used each time. This is now happening almost every other day, morning and night.
What can she do to stop/filter this SMS bombing or report it effectively? Has anyone dealt with something similar?
